Dr. Tilden's Health Review and Critique V14: 1939 is a book written by J.H. Tilden. The book is a compilation of articles and essays written by Tilden, a renowned natural health practitioner, during the year 1939. The book covers a wide range of topics related to natural health, including the benefits of a plant-based diet, the dangers of processed foods, the importance of exercise, and the role of mental health in overall well-being. Tilden's writing is clear and concise, making complex health concepts easy to understand for readers of all backgrounds. The book is an excellent resource for anyone interested in natural health and wellness, and it provides valuable insights into the mind of one of the most influential natural health practitioners of the 20th century.Dr. J. H. Tilden Of Denver, Colorado Was Regarded As The Father Of American Naturopathic Medicine, Health And Diet.
